« Message de traitement (file d'attente) » : différence entre les versions

De Wiki1000
Aucun résumé des modifications
Aucun résumé des modifications
Ligne 17 : Ligne 17 :
|}
|}


Le type de l'action réalisée doit être contenu dans le paramètre "message.action"
{| class="wikitable"
|-
!Action
!Usage
|-
|[[Message print (msg)|print]]
|
|-
|[[Message preview (msg)|preview]]
|
|-
|[[Message import (msg)|import]]
|
|-
|[[Message export (msg)|export]]
|
|-
|[[Message importformat (msg)|importformat]]
|
|-
|[[Message importdip (msg)|importdip]]
|
|-
|[[Message delete (msg)|delete]]
|
|-
|[[Message planification (msg)|planification]]
|
|-
|[[Message event (msg)|event]]
|
|-
|[[Message processus (msg)|processus]]
|
|-
|[[Message process (msg)|process]]
|
|-
|[[Message task (msg)|task]]
|
|-
|[[Message admin (msg)|admin]]
|
|-
|[[Message test (msg)|test]]
|
|}


Le type de l'action réalisée doit être contenu dans le paramètre "message.action"


'''Valeur de message.action = "importdip" '''
'''Valeur de message.action = "importdip" '''

Version du 7 février 2019 à 09:43

Le message de traitement est utilisé pour déclencher un traitement métier.

Tip : Vous pouvez utiliser le Sync Agent pour poster ce type de message dans une file d'attente

Paramètres communs

Paramètre Utilisation
message.action Type d'action
message.accessToken Jeton d'authentification

Le type de l'action réalisée doit être contenu dans le paramètre "message.action"

Action Usage
print
preview
import
export
importformat
importdip
delete
planification
event
processus
process
task
admin
test


Valeur de message.action = "importdip"

Paramètre Utilisation
import.name nom du descriptif à utiliser (dip)
import.options Options d'importation (séparées par une virgule)
import.shareMode Mode de partage

Valeur de message.action = "importformat"

Paramètre Utilisation
import.name nom du descriptif à utiliser (dip)
import.options Options d'importation (séparées par une virgule)
import.shareMode Mode de partage

Valeur de message.action = "processus"

Paramètre Utilisation
processus.className Nom de la classe du processus à instancier
processus.methodName Nom de la méthode du processus à exécuter
processus.parameters.className Nom de la classe des paramètres du processus
processus.parameters.code Code des paramètres du processus

Remarques :

  • Pour l'appel du processus d'import métier, la méthode à appeler est ExecuterAutomate.
  • Dans le cas de l'instanciation de processus, la méthode doit retourner une valeur entière qui indique le succès de l'opération.
Attention : en cas de succès le résultat doit être zéro


Voir aussi: